Perfect for baby spinach and mature harvest.
Healthy plants produce plenty of tender, smooth, dark-green leaves. We find them perfect for both baby spinach when harvested young and still tender and mild when left in the garden for fully mature harvests. Rust resistant for robust growth all season.
